Handover — Contract Transfer

Jonas: signed Veltrane contracts leaving Harrowgate office today, bound for the Aldmere site. Two sealed folders, blue tape, initialled by legal. Do not open or copy. Log arrival time on the intake sheet and notify records immediately. Return the empty transit pouch with the same courier. The courier's confidential hand-over instruction is stated on the line below.

handover note for yagef-bagep: the drudor pelius courier leaves the kasdor zorvan norir ledger at gate 8016 under passcode 755406

## Changelog — Ticktrace 1.9

### Renamed: DRIFT_API_TOKEN
During the cron drift investigation we found plugins confusing this variable with the metrics token, so it has been renamed to indicate it authorizes drift-report uploads specifically. Plugin authors must read the new name from 1.9 onward; the old name is ignored without warning. Sample env files in the SDK are updated. In your deployment env file, the drift-report upload secret is set on the next line.

env line for fawef-taguf: VAULT_KEY13=a9695905a9a90

**14:32 —** Pixbin image cache leak confirmed. Heap grows ~40 MB/hr because evicted thumbnails keep a ref through the decoder pool. Marla's patch frees the pool entry on eviction; soak test looks clean after two hours. Rolling forward rather than back. The fix first landed in the build stamped below.

trace token, fafog-faduf: htk3_4e2

## Ticket: Evaluate permessage-deflate on Wrenlock Gateway

We need a decision on enabling websocket compression for the Wrenlock realtime layer. Benchmarks show ~40% bandwidth savings on chat payloads but a 12–18% CPU increase per node and higher memory per connection due to sliding-window buffers. Mobile clients benefit most; server fleet may need two extra nodes. Please review the attached benchmark notes, note any objections in comments, and do not merge until sign-off is recorded by the approver named below.

approver of yawig-yajef = Briius Jorix